Power Consumption



load (wPrime 1024M, peak during first minute) Watt Index
Intel Core i7-4770K 4.5G 169 123.36 %
Intel Core i7-3770K 4.5G 149 108.76 %
Intel Core i7-2600K 4.5G 155 113.14 %
Intel Core i7-4770K Stock 123 89.78 %
Intel Core i7-3770K Stock 120 87.59 %
Intel Core i7-2600K Stock 137 100.00 %
  less is better


peak (LinX, peak during first run) Watt Index
Intel Core i7-4770K 4.5G 190 125.00 %
Intel Core i7-3770K 4.5G 170 111.84 %
Intel Core i7-2600K 4.5G 175 115.13 %
Intel Core i7-4770K Stock 134 88.16 %
Intel Core i7-3770K Stock 131 86.18 %
Intel Core i7-2600K Stock 152 100.00 %
 

less is better
